How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Palms?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Palms Studio Apartments | $2,539 | $1,295 | $4,118 |
| Palms 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,304 | $1,380 | $10,000+ |
| Palms 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,581 | $2,295 | $10,000+ |
| Palms 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,986 | $3,300 | $10,000+ |
| Palms 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,335 | $4,295 | $6,595 |
